Meet the Artist Behind Downtown Bellevue's New Intersection Artwork

Esmeralda Vasquez, a Latinx/LGBTQ+ artist, is set to unveil her new intersection artwork titled 'The Love Between' in Downtown Bellevue, celebrating LGBTQIA+ pride. The installation features vibrant color-blocked hands and flowers representing the queer community, symbolizing growth and inclusivity. The project aims to foster community connection and recognition and will be completed by the end of May, just in time for Pride Month.

Sound Transit East Link 2 Line Update

The Sound Transit East Link 2 Line opened on April 27, 2024, featuring eight stations that enhance connectivity between Bellevue and Redmond with frequent service. Future expansions are set to add more stations in Redmond by August 2024, with a full connection to downtown Seattle anticipated by 2025.

Paws Pride Dog Walk Finds New Home at Bellevue Downtown Park, Returns June 1

The Paws & Pride Dog Walk returns on June 1, 2024, at Bellevue Downtown Park, celebrating LGBTQIA+ pride. Organized by the Bellevue Downtown Association and Eastside Pride PNW, the event features a dog walk, festivities, and supports local charities. Registration is open, with donations benefiting Seattle Humane and Lambert House.
